![]() |
ERIS CORE
|
const int16_t PROGMEM wt_21[] = {0, 430, 864, 1303, 1751, 2212, 2686, 3175, 3683, 4211, 4758, 5327, 5916, 6526, 7156, 7806, 8473, 9157, 9854, 10562, 11281, 12007, 12737, 13469, 14201, 14931, 15654, 16371, 17079, 17777, 18462, 19133, 19791, 20432, 21059, 21670, 22264, 22841, 23402, 23947, 24477, 24990, 25488, 25971, 26438, 26890, 27327, 27749, 28156, 28548, 28924, 29283, 29628, 29955, 30266, 30558, 30834, 31092, 31330, 31551, 31752, 31937, 32101, 32247, 32374, 32483, 32574, 32647, 32703, 32742, 32763, 32767, 32757, 32729, 32684, 32623, 32546, 32454, 32344, 32219, 32075, 31917, 31739, 31545, 31333, 31103, 30856, 30592, 30310, 30011, 29695, 29363, 29016, 28654, 28280, 27893, 27495, 27087, 26672, 26248, 25820, 25389, 24953, 24516, 24078, 23641, 23206, 22771, 22339, 21909, 21482, 21056, 20632, 20210, 19788, 19367, 18945, 18521, 18096, 17667, 17235, 16800, 16361, 15918, 15470, 15019, 14564, 14106, 13648, 13189, 12731, 12276, 11825, 11379, 10940, 10512, 10094, 9689, 9297, 8921, 8561, 8219, 7896, 7589, 7302, 7033, 6781, 6548, 6332, 6130, 5944, 5771, 5610, 5460, 5320, 5188, 5064, 4947, 4834, 4728, 4625, 4528, 4435, 4348, 4266, 4190, 4123, 4064, 4013, 3973, 3944, 3930, 3929, 3942, 3973, 4018, 4081, 4161, 4259, 4373, 4503, 4649, 4807, 4981, 5165, 5360, 5564, 5772, 5988, 6207, 6426, 6646, 6865, 7081, 7293, 7500, 7700, 7895, 8083, 8265, 8440, 8608, 8770, 8927, 9078, 9227, 9373, 9514, 9655, 9795, 9934, 10074, 10214, 10356, 10499, 10643, 10788, 10936, 11085, 11235, 11385, 11536, 11686, 11835, 11983, 12130, 12275, 12417, 12556, 12691, 12825, 12953, 13079, 13199, 13316, 13430, 13539, 13643, 13743, 13838, 13927, 14012, 14091, 14163, 14229, 14288, 14339, 14381, 14413, 14436, 14448, 14450, 14438, 14416, 14380, 14332, 14271, 14197, 14111, 14011, 13902, 13780, 13651, 13512, 13365, 13212, 13053, 12891, 12727, 12560, 12394, 12230, 12067, 11905, 11748, 11594, 11443, 11295, 11150, 11008, 10867, 10726, 10587, 10445, 10301, 10153, 10000, 9841, 9675, 9502, 9320, 9129, 8930, 8721, 8504, 8280, 8047, 7809, 7567, 7322, 7077, 6831, 6588, 6350, 6118, 5895, 5682, 5482, 5293, 5121, 4962, 4822, 4697, 4588, 4495, 4420, 4358, 4312, 4279, 4258, 4246, 4245, 4249, 4262, 4278, 4297, 4319, 4342, 4366, 4388, 4411, 4434, 4455, 4478, 4499, 4523, 4550, 4579, 4612, 4651, 4698, 4750, 4812, 4883, 4966, 5058, 5161, 5276, 5403, 5541, 5689, 5849, 6017, 6194, 6379, 6571, 6768, 6968, 7172, 7378, 7583, 7788, 7991, 8191, 8389, 8583, 8772, 8955, 9135, 9309, 9478, 9642, 9802, 9957, 10107, 10253, 10396, 10534, 10669, 10802, 10931, 11059, 11183, 11303, 11423, 11540, 11653, 11765, 11873, 11979, 12083, 12184, 12282, 12380, 12475, 12569, 12662, 12753, 12844, 12935, 13027, 13119, 13213, 13307, 13403, 13499, 13598, 13696, 13794, 13892, 13989, 14083, 14174, 14260, 14339, 14410, 14473, 14524, 14563, 14587, 14597, 14588, 14564, 14519, 14455, 14372, 14268, 14146, 14001, 13840, 13660, 13465, 13252, 13027, 12790, 12544, 12289, 12028, 11764, 11497, 11229, 10963, 10700, 10440, 10186, 9935, 9691, 9452, 9218, 8989, 8764, 8543, 8323, 8104, 7884, 7662, 7437, 7207, 6970, 6727, 6477, 6216, 5946, 5667, 5378, 5081, 4774, 4459, 4138, 3812, 3479, 3146, 2809, 2474, 2140, 1810, 1485, 1165, 852, 549, 255, -29, -302, -565, -815, -1055, -1286, -1505, -1715, -1915, -2107, -2291, -2468, -2639, -2802, -2962, -3115, -3263, -3407, -3546, -3679, -3809, -3932, -4049, -4160, -4262, -4357, -4443, -4521, -4590, -4647, -4694, -4731, -4756, -4769, -4772, -4763, -4743, -4714, -4674, -4625, -4567, -4502, -4427, -4347, -4259, -4166, -4066, -3962, -3853, -3739, -3619, -3495, -3366, -3231, -3091, -2944, -2791, -2631, -2465, -2291, -2108, -1918, -1721, -1515, -1303, -1082, -855, -623, -384, -141, 105, 354, 605, 856, 1107, 1357, 1604, 1849, 2088, 2324, 2556, 2781, 3004, 3219, 3431, 3639, 3841, 4042, 4238, 4432, 4626, 4820, 5014, 5207, 5402, 5598, 5796, 5995, 6195, 6395, 6596, 6796, 6994, 7190, 7382, 7568, 7749, 7922, 8087, 8240, 8383, 8514, 8630, 8733, 8822, 8897, 8957, 9001, 9033, 9051, 9056, 9048, 9030, 9001, 8964, 8920, 8869, 8812, 8751, 8685, 8617, 8545, 8472, 8395, 8316, 8235, 8149, 8060, 7966, 7867, 7761, 7647, 7524, 7394, 7250, 7098, 6934, 6756, 6568, 6367, 6153, 5928, 5693, 5447, 5192, 4930, 4660, 4387, 4109, 3828, 3548, 3268, 2991, 2717, 2446, 2182, 1923, 1671, 1426, 1187, 956, 730, 510, 294, 83, -124, -330, -535, -737, -942, -1146, -1354, -1564, -1776, -1992, -2212, -2433, -2658, -2884, -3113, -3342, -3570, -3799, -4023, -4245, -4463, -4674, -4880, -5077, -5265, -5445, -5615, -5773, -5922, -6058, -6182, -6296, -6398, -6489, -6568, -6635, -6693, -6739, -6776, -6801, -6817, -6823, -6818, -6804, -6781, -6746, -6702, -6648, -6583, -6508, -6422, -6325, -6217, -6100, -5974, -5835, -5688, -5531, -5367, -5195, -5016, -4831, -4641, -4447, -4252, -4052, -3852, -3652, -3450, -3251, -3050, -2853, -2655, -2460, -2262, -2067, -1869, -1669, -1466, -1258, -1043, -823, -592, -351, -100, 164, 442, 734, 1041, 1363, 1699, 2051, 2416, 2795, 3186, 3587, 3998, 4416, 4838, 5264, 5690, 6115, 6537, 6953, 7360, 7759, 8146, 8521, 8881, 9228, 9560, 9875, 10176, 10460, 10730, 10987, 11229, 11460, 11680, 11889, 12091, 12285, 12472, 12655, 12835, 13010, 13184, 13355, 13525, 13693, 13860, 14025, 14189, 14350, 14508, 14661, 14810, 14955, 15093, 15225, 15349, 15465, 15572, 15672, 15763, 15843, 15915, 15977, 16031, 16076, 16112, 16140, 16160, 16173, 16179, 16178, 16170, 16157, 16136, 16109, 16075, 16034, 15986, 15930, 15865, 15791, 15710, 15617, 15512, 15397, 15270, 15132, 14980, 14817, 14641, 14454, 14254, 14043, 13820, 13590, 13349, 13101, 12845, 12584, 12320, 12049, 11778, 11506, 11232, 10958, 10685, 10413, 10142, 9874, 9605, 9337, 9071, 8805, 8538, 8269, 7998, 7723, 7444, 7162, 6874, 6579, 6279, 5972, 5658, 5338, 5011, 4678, 4341, 3999, 3655, 3306, 2959, 2612, 2266, 1924, 1586, 1254, 930, 612, 306, 7, -280, -556, -822, -1076, -1320, -1553, -1775, -1988, -2192, -2388, -2576, -2757, -2933, -3102, -3268, -3429, -3585, -3738, -3887, -4034, -4175, -4313, -4447, -4576, -4701, -4819, -4932, -5038, -5138, -5231, -5315, -5393, -5464, -5527, -5585, -5635, -5679, -5721, -5756, -5790, -5820, -5849, -5878, -5909, -5939, -5973, -6011, -6049, -6093, -6140, -6190, -6243, -6300, -6357, -6416, -6474, -6532, -6587, -6638, -6684, -6723, -6755, -6779, -6793, -6796, -6789, -6769, -6737, -6694, -6640, -6574, -6499, -6414, -6320, -6220, -6115, -6003, -5890, -5775, -5661, -5547, -5436, -5328, -5224, -5126, -5033, -4946, -4866, -4792, -4723, -4659, -4601, -4547, -4497, -4449, -4404, -4360, -4316, -4272, -4228, -4182, -4134, -4085, -4032, -3977, -3920, -3862, -3801, -3739, -3676, -3612, -3547, -3483, -3418, -3354, -3289, -3226, -3162, -3097, -3032, -2966, -2898, -2827, -2754, -2675, -2592, -2503, -2407, -2303, -2192, -2071, -1942, -1804, -1656, -1498, -1332, -1158, -978, -790, -598, -401, -201, 0, 201, 401, 598, 790, 978, 1159, 1332, 1499, 1656, 1803, 1941, 2071, 2192, 2303, 2407, 2503, 2592, 2675, 2754, 2828, 2898, 2966, 3032, 3097, 3161, 3225, 3288, 3354, 3418, 3483, 3548, 3612, 3676, 3740, 3802, 3862, 3921, 3977, 4031, 4084, 4133, 4181, 4227, 4273, 4316, 4360, 4404, 4449, 4497, 4547, 4601, 4659, 4723, 4791, 4865, 4946, 5033, 5126, 5224, 5328, 5436, 5547, 5660, 5776, 5890, 6003, 6115, 6220, 6321, 6413, 6498, 6575, 6640, 6694, 6737, 6768, 6788, 6795, 6792, 6779, 6755, 6723, 6684, 6638, 6586, 6532, 6474, 6416, 6357, 6299, 6244, 6190, 6140, 6094, 6050, 6010, 5973, 5940, 5908, 5879, 5849, 5820, 5788, 5756, 5720, 5680, 5634, 5584, 5528, 5463, 5393, 5315, 5230, 5138, 5038, 4932, 4819, 4700, 4576, 4447, 4313, 4176, 4033, 3887, 3737, 3585, 3429, 3268, 3103, 2934, 2758, 2577, 2388, 2192, 1988, 1775, 1553, 1319, 1076, 822, 556, 280, -7, -305, -613, -930, -1254, -1586, -1924, -2266, -2612, -2960, -3307, -3654, -4000, -4342, -4678, -5011, -5338, -5658, -5972, -6279, -6580, -6873, -7162, -7445, -7724, -7997, -8269, -8537, -8805, -9072, -9338, -9604, -9873, -10142, -10413, -10685, -10958, -11232, -11505, -11779, -12050, -12318, -12584, -12845, -13101, -13350, -13590, -13821, -14042, -14254, -14453, -14642, -14817, -14981, -15132, -15270, -15398, -15512, -15616, -15709, -15793, -15866, -15930, -15986, -16035, -16075, -16108, -16136, -16157, -16171, -16178, -16180, -16174, -16161, -16140, -16112, -16076, -16032, -15977, -15915, -15844, -15762, -15673, -15573, -15465, -15348, -15224, -15093, -14954, -14810, -14662, -14507, -14350, -14189, -14025, -13860, -13693, -13525, -13355, -13184, -13010, -12834, -12656, -12473, -12284, -12091, -11889, -11679, -11460, -11229, -10986, -10731, -10460, -10175, -9875, -9559, -9228, -8882, -8521, -8146, -7759, -7361, -6953, -6536, -6115, -5690, -5264, -4838, -4415, -3998, -3587, -3186, -2795, -2416, -2051, -1699, -1363, -1041, -734, -442, -165, 100, 351, 593, 822, 1043, 1258, 1466, 1669, 1869, 2067, 2263, 2460, 2656, 2853, 3051, 3250, 3451, 3651, 3852, 4053, 4251, 4448, 4642, 4831, 5017, 5195, 5368, 5532, 5688, 5835, 5973, 6101, 6218, 6325, 6422, 6507, 6583, 6648, 6702, 6746, 6780, 6805, 6818, 6823, 6817, 6801, 6775, 6739, 6693, 6636, 6567, 6488, 6397, 6296, 6182, 6057, 5920, 5773, 5614, 5446, 5266, 5078, 4880, 4675, 4462, 4246, 4024, 3798, 3571, 3342, 3114, 2885, 2657, 2433, 2211, 1993, 1777, 1564, 1354, 1147, 942, 737, 534, 329, 124, -83, -294, -510, -729, -955, -1188, -1426, -1671, -1924, -2181, -2446, -2716, -2990, -3268, -3547, -3828, -4109, -4386, -4661, -4930, -5193, -5448, -5693, -5929, -6153, -6366, -6567, -6756, -6932, -7098, -7251, -7393, -7524, -7647, -7761, -7866, -7966, -8060, -8149, -8235, -8316, -8394, -8472, -8545, -8617, -8685, -8751, -8812, -8869, -8920, -8965, -9002, -9030, -9048, -9055, -9050, -9033, -9001, -8956, -8896, -8822, -8733, -8630, -8513, -8383, -8240, -8086, -7922, -7750, -7568, -7383, -7191, -6994, -6795, -6596, -6395, -6194, -5995, -5796, -5599, -5402, -5207, -5014, -4820, -4627, -4433, -4238, -4041, -3841, -3638, -3431, -3220, -3004, -2782, -2555, -2324, -2089, -1849, -1604, -1356, -1107, -857, -605, -355, -106, 142, 384, 622, 856, 1082, 1302, 1516, 1720, 1918, 2108, 2291, 2464, 2631, 2791, 2944, 3090, 3231, 3366, 3495, 3620, 3738, 3853, 3963, 4067, 4166, 4258, 4346, 4428, 4501, 4568, 4626, 4674, 4714, 4743, 4763, 4771, 4769, 4755, 4730, 4694, 4646, 4590, 4522, 4443, 4358, 4262, 4159, 4049, 3932, 3809, 3680, 3546, 3407, 3264, 3116, 2961, 2803, 2639, 2468, 2291, 2108, 1916, 1715, 1505, 1285, 1056, 815, 564, 302, 29, -256, -550, -853, -1164, -1484, -1809, -2140, -2474, -2810, -3145, -3480, -3812, -4139, -4460, -4774, -5080, -5379, -5666, -5945, -6215, -6476, -6727, -6970, -7207, -7437, -7662, -7884, -8104, -8323, -8543, -8765, -8989, -9218, -9452, -9691, -9935, -10185, -10441, -10700, -10964, -11229, -11497, -11763, -12028, -12290, -12543, -12791, -13028, -13252, -13463, -13661, -13840, -14002, -14145, -14268, -14372, -14456, -14520, -14563, -14589, -14597, -14587, -14563, -14523, -14473, -14411, -14339, -14260, -14174, -14083, -13989, -13892, -13795, -13696, -13598, -13499, -13403, -13307, -13213, -13120, -13028, -12935, -12844, -12753, -12661, -12568, -12475, -12380, -12283, -12183, -12083, -11979, -11872, -11765, -11653, -11539, -11423, -11303, -11183, -11058, -10932, -10802, -10670, -10535, -10395, -10253, -10106, -9956, -9802, -9643, -9479, -9309, -9135, -8955, -8771, -8582, -8389, -8191, -7991, -7788, -7583, -7377, -7172, -6969, -6768, -6570, -6380, -6194, -6018, -5849, -5690, -5541, -5402, -5276, -5161, -5058, -4965, -4883, -4812, -4751, -4696, -4652, -4612, -4580, -4550, -4524, -4499, -4477, -4455, -4433, -4411, -4388, -4365, -4341, -4319, -4298, -4277, -4261, -4249, -4244, -4247, -4257, -4279, -4313, -4359, -4420, -4495, -4587, -4696, -4821, -4963, -5120, -5293, -5481, -5682, -5896, -6119, -6350, -6588, -6831, -7076, -7323, -7568, -7810, -8047, -8279, -8504, -8721, -8930, -9129, -9319, -9502, -9676, -9841, -10000, -10152, -10301, -10445, -10586, -10727, -10867, -11008, -11150, -11294, -11443, -11593, -11748, -11905, -12067, -12229, -12395, -12561, -12727, -12891, -13054, -13211, -13365, -13511, -13650, -13781, -13901, -14012, -14109, -14196, -14271, -14332, -14380, -14415, -14439, -14449, -14448, -14436, -14413, -14380, -14338, -14287, -14228, -14163, -14090, -14012, -13927, -13838, -13743, -13644, -13539, -13430, -13317, -13200, -13078, -12953, -12825, -12692, -12556, -12416, -12274, -12129, -11983, -11835, -11685, -11535, -11385, -11235, -11084, -10937, -10789, -10643, -10498, -10355, -10214, -10073, -9934, -9794, -9654, -9514, -9372, -9227, -9079, -8927, -8770, -8607, -8440, -8264, -8084, -7895, -7699, -7500, -7293, -7081, -6865, -6646, -6427, -6206, -5989, -5773, -5564, -5361, -5165, -4981, -4808, -4648, -4502, -4372, -4259, -4161, -4082, -4019, -3972, -3942, -3929, -3929, -3944, -3973, -4012, -4063, -4122, -4191, -4265, -4348, -4435, -4527, -4626, -4727, -4834, -4946, -5064, -5189, -5320, -5460, -5611, -5771, -5944, -6130, -6332, -6548, -6781, -7033, -7301, -7589, -7895, -8219, -8561, -8921, -9297, -9688, -10094, -10512, -10941, -11379, -11824, -12275, -12731, -13189, -13648, -14107, -14564, -15019, -15469, -15917, -16360, -16800, -17236, -17668, -18097, -18521, -18945, -19367, -19789, -20210, -20633, -21056, -21482, -21909, -22338, -22771, -23206, -23641, -24079, -24516, -24952, -25388, -25820, -26249, -26672, -27087, -27495, -27892, -28280, -28655, -29016, -29363, -29695, -30010, -30311, -30592, -30857, -31104, -31333, -31546, -31739, -31916, -32076, -32218, -32344, -32454, -32546, -32623, -32684, -32728, -32756, -32768, -32763, -32742, -32703, -32647, -32574, -32484, -32374, -32246, -32100, -31936, -31753, -31551, -31330, -31090, -30834, -30559, -30266, -29955, -29627, -29283, -28924, -28547, -28156, -27749, -27327, -26890, -26437, -25970, -25488, -24990, -24477, -23947, -23402, -22842, -22264, -21669, -21058, -20432, -19791, -19134, -18461, -17776, -17079, -16371, -15655, -14930, -14201, -13469, -12737, -12007, -11281, -10562, -9853, -9156, -8473, -7805, -7157, -6525, -5915, -5326, -4758, -4211, -3683, -3175, -2686, -2212, -1752, -1303, -863, -431} |
Definition at line 50 of file eris_waveshapes.cpp.